Job Options (Help me Decide - first job)

After a long year of grinding, I ended up with basically two options:

Option 1: JLL/CBRE in Tier 2 market

Option 2: AM at fast growing REPE shop that is probably getting hurt right now because of buying so much.

-

Option 1: I will have to relocate to a city that I probably wouldn't want to be in longterm. Plus the market is a wasteland for brokerage and base is low. No clue what all in would be.

Option 2: Keeps me near home, tier 1 city. Don't want to be in AM as a career. base is 70-75k with 18-22% bonus

I am struggling to make this decision and neither really seem ideal. If I started in institutional brokerage I might make barely anything but could probably get an option 2 job easier. Neither comp is really exciting to me tbh. Kinda disappointing but what would you choose?
